Есть такая задача: имеется комната, в комнате на стенах расположено 100 светодиодов. нужно с компьютера через COM-порт выборочно зажигать от 1 до 10 светодиодов. Еще в распоряжении есть ардуино уно, навыки его программирования и начальные познания в электронике. Как можно решить такую задачу? (проблема в том, чтобы при помощи десятка выводов ардуино контролировать 100 светодиодов)
Вот например человек сначала перепутал полярность, а переделывать было лень, поэтому в статье много грязных технических подробностей про решение дополнительной проблемы.
Можно использовать драйверы серии MBI50XX, сдвиговый регистр+источник тока — даже резисторы не нужны. В Lightpack используется такая микросхема (MBI5026 — 16 каналов), по деньгам меньше доллара штука.